About The Palm Miami
Is The Palm Miami worth it for a first dinner in Bay Harbor Islands? Yes, if the goal is a steakhouse meal with seafood and Italian options at dinner. The basics are direct: The Palm Miami is a Bay Harbor Islands restaurant serving steakhouse, seafood, Italian dishes, with a listed price signal of about $60 per person.
The format should be approached as a dinner choice rather than a lunch stop. Service is listed for evenings only: Monday through Saturday from 5–10 PM, Sunday from 4–9 PM. The restaurant also has Wine Spectator Award of Excellence recognition for 2026, but the most useful planning details are still the cuisine, price, hours, dress code, signature dishes.
Go for steakhouse, seafood, Italian comfort
The Palm Miami is best understood as a steakhouse-style dinner in Bay Harbor Islands. The cuisine categories are steakhouse, seafood, Italian, so it works well when the table wants those categories.
Signature dishes include Prime New York Strip, Lobster Bisque, Jumbo Lump Crab Cake, Lobster Ravioli, Key Lime Pie. That gives first-timers a clear path through the menu: start with a seafood-leaning appetizer or soup, choose steak or pasta as the center of the meal, finish with dessert.
At about $60 per person, value depends on how the meal is ordered. The listed price gives a useful planning baseline, but a steakhouse dinner can vary depending on selections. The safest expectation is to treat The Palm Miami as a dinner option with a clear price signal rather than as a quick daytime meal.

Private-club-like, old-school steakhouse atmosphere with timeless elegance and modern sophistication; the venue is described as warm, inviting, and wood-heavy with a classic, clubby feel.
